Transaction 58e862f34374a2e19353443a4d601923d6928cfeeded64b5aaa1ea4b30da96f4
1 Input
1 Output
-
58e862f34374a2e19353443a4d601923d6928cfeeded64b5aaa1ea4b30da96f4:0
- value
- 63812
- script pubkey
- OP_0 OP_PUSHBYTES_20 2ca615071e9e3b797c0e4f6fd49c8e9d1cd78139
- address
- bc1q9jnp2pc7ncahjlqwfahaf8ywn5wd0qfelegx3g